Frequently Asked Questions

What is the primary difference between link and image buttons?

The primary difference is that link buttons use text for navigation or linking, while image buttons use images as their primary interactive element.

Which button type is more accessible?

Link buttons are generally more accessible because they are text-based and can be easily read by screen readers, though image buttons can also be accessible with proper alt text.

How can I make image buttons accessible?

You can make image buttons accessible by adding alt text that describes the image and its purpose, ensuring that the image does not rely on color alone to convey information, and providing a text alternative for users who cannot see the image.

Do image buttons load faster than link buttons?

Generally, no. Image buttons can load slower than link buttons because they require loading an image file, which can be larger in size than text. However, optimizing image files can mitigate this issue.
